Lynbrook Golf Club August Civic Holiday Golf Tournament

-

The Lynbrook Golf Club held its annual August Civic Holiday Golf Tournament under ideal conditions for a summer golf tournament. There was a good turnout of 64 golfers in the three divisions.

The Men’s Civic Holiday Champion was Brett Sentes with a 5 under par 66 and that was 4 better than Nick Lepine with a 70. Shaun Muchowski came in 3rd in the Championsh­ip flight from the white tee’s.

The winner of Men’s 1st flight on the low gross side was Scott McGregor who shot a 82, and that was same score as Josh Huschi with a 82 but John lost via retrogress­ion. The net side of the 1st flight was won by Jack Astleford with a 69 and that was three better than Lee Longworth. The 2nd flight of the white tee division was won by Tim Peakman with a score of 85 and that was 1 better than Keith Gieni with a score of 86. The low net side of that flight was won by Adam Bachiu with a score of 69 and he beat out Brady Rosnes with a score of 75. The Men’s Division from the Red Tee’s Championsh­ip won by Dwight Baron who shot 3 under his age, and that gave him a 70. Retrogress­ion settled 2nd and 3rd in the Championsh­ip for the Red Tee’s and that was won by Jim Swaok over Jeff Fowlie with identical scores of 76. The 1st Flight from the Red Tee’s was won by Steve Wright with a excellent score of 73 and that beat out Marv Maiers with a score of 81. Low net in the 1st Flight was won by Al Davey and he won via retrogress­ion over Bob Turnbull as both players had 67.

The 2nd Flight from the Red Tee’s was won by Don Thompson and that also won via retrogress­ion over Ken Jattensing­h as both players shot 84. Low net was also settled via retrogress­ion and that a battle between Don McDonald and Russell Whitsitt who both fired scores of 68. The 3rd flight was won by Rocky Laselle who shot a 87 and Marv Schaitel came in 2nd with a score of 94. Low net in that Flight was won by Brendon Norman with a 66 to edge out Ted Swenson who was just one stroke behind with a score of 67.

The Ladies Champion for the Civic Holiday Tournament was won by Lori Bernt and Lori posted a fine round of

84. That was one less than Ethel Akins with a score of

85. Low net in that Flight was won by Linda Stirton over Sandy Davey and that was also settled via retrogress­ion in another extremely close match.

The Ladies 2nd flight was won by Adele Owatz with a 91 and that was enough to beat out Sherron Bearchell who came in 2nd. Low Net in the Ladies 1st Flight was won by Eileen Palmer with a score of 72 and Elsie Sapach came in 2nd with a score of 76.

Ladies closest to the pin on Hole # 5 was won by Sandy Davey and the Men’s closest to the pin was won by Tim Peakman on Hole # 7.
